Output 8c70a8314327294dd3b68a33ff661d0aeebbedc97720eaa66d845d97c62b67d2:1

value
448330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1ed105c0c12d6ce7dcccbfc98649cfe65122977 OP_EQUAL
address
3Lq198DJQehCyzahrbWYGUQaaV87x7H2jD
transaction
8c70a8314327294dd3b68a33ff661d0aeebbedc97720eaa66d845d97c62b67d2
spent
true